Basil ‘Rita from STK
2 oz. Don Julio Reposado
½ oz. Triple sec
½ oz Fresh sour
1 Lime squeezed
Basil
Muddle the basil and lime juice in cocktail shaker before adding the tequila, triple sec, fresh sour mix, and ice. Shake and strain into a tumbler.
Perfectly Peachy Margarita

2 oz. Sauza Blue Silver 100% Agave Tequila
½ oz. DeKuyper Peach Schnapps
½ oz. JDK & Sons™ O3 Premium Orange Liqueur
1 oz. fresh squeezed lime juice
½ part Peach Nectar
Peach wedge for garnish
In a pitcher filled with ice, combine the tequila, peach schnapps, orange liqueur, lime juice and peach nectar. Stir to combine. Chill and serve over ice in prepared glasses.
Blood Orange Margarita

2 oz. Cruz Reposado Tequila
1/2 oz. Cointreau Orange Liqueur
1/2 oz. agave nectar
1/2 oz. blood orange squeezed
1 lime squeezed
1-2 oz. filtered water
Shake all ingredients with ice and strain over fresh ice. Garnish with a blood orange slice
Slim and Sparkling Lemon Lime Margarita

3 oz. Lemon Lime Sparkling ICE
1 ½ oz. Tequila
Splash of fresh squeezed orange
Fresh squeezed lime
Shake and pour into a chilled rocks glass rimmed in salt. Garnish with a lime slice.
Wise Margarita
1 oz. fresh pressed watermelon juice
1 oz. Owl’s Brew Pink & Black
1 oz. tequila
Shake over ice with mint, and garnish with mint, lime, and watermelon.
Rita Rioja

1 ½ oz. Tequila Avión Reposado
¾ oz. Fresh Squeezed Lime Juice
¾ oz. Simple Syrup (equal parts sugar and water)
Fresh Red Pepper
Cilantro
Muddle a fresh red pepper and a few leaves of cilantro in a cocktail shaker. Add the tequila, fresh lime juice, and simple syrup. Fill cocktail shaker with ice and shake vigorously. Strain into a salt rimmed cocktail glass.
